## Roadmap
Updated at: 2021/10/04

As with any roadmap, this is a living document that will evolve as priorities and dependencies shift; we aim to update the roadmap with any changes or status updates every quarter.

#### Deploy from Git push
Deploy directly from Git repositories

#### Monitoring system
- Smart alerts specific for Meteor apps and Galaxy servers
- APM improvements in general

#### Improve Debugging
- Server-side CPU and memory profiling
- Ability to attach the Node inspector

#### Native app build and publish
Build and publish Meteor Mobile Native apps to App Store and Google Play :rocket:

## Recently completed

#### Free MongoDB
Shared MongoDB hosting is [available](https://www.meteor.com/cloud) for non-production apps

#### Free deploy
Free deploy is [back](https://www.meteor.com/cloud) :wink: for non-production apps

#### Improve Logs UI
Better search and date navigation - [Watch here](https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=WPYyHeWM21Q)

#### Improve UI Performance
Better memory and CPU consumption from Galaxy UI in the browser

#### Build cache on deploy
Cache the build to deploy to different environments or to retry the upload (Meteor 1.11) - [Read more](https://galaxy-guide.meteor.com/deploy-guide.html#cache-build)

#### Two-factor authentication
Two-factor authentication - [Read more](https://galaxy-guide.meteor.com/security.html#two-factor-authentication)

#### App Protection
Security layer to prevent attacks - [Read more](https://galaxy-guide.meteor.com/protection.html)

#### Public API
Public API so you can extend Galaxy features as you wish - [Read more](https://galaxy-guide.meteor.com/api.html)

#### Auto-scaling
Auto-scaling :smile: - [Read more](https://galaxy-guide.meteor.com/triggers.html)

#### Notifications
Receive activities (right side panel of Galaxy) on your email or Slack. - [Read more](https://galaxy-guide.meteor.com/notifications.html)

#### Allow changing settings
Change Meteor settings from UI

#### Pricing
- Tiny containers: designed for hobby projects and open-source demos, starting from $7/month. No minimum charge, pay for only what you use. [Read more](https://www.meteor.com/hosting#pricing)
